#ifndef SPACEINFOOBSERVER_H
#define SPACEINFOOBSERVER_H
-#include <QObject>
-
#include <KIO/Job>
-class KUrl;
+#include <QObject>
+
+class QUrl;
class MountPointObserver;
class SpaceInfoObserver : public QObject
Q_OBJECT
public:
- explicit SpaceInfoObserver(const KUrl& url, QObject* parent = 0);
- virtual ~SpaceInfoObserver();
+ explicit SpaceInfoObserver(const QUrl& url, QObject* parent = nullptr);
+ ~SpaceInfoObserver() override;
quint64 size() const;
quint64 available() const;
- void setUrl(const KUrl& url);
+ void setUrl(const QUrl& url);
signals:
/**